Man Utd 5-2 Ipswich: Bruno Fernandes scores hat-trick to help United come from behind to win at Old Trafford

Bruno Fernandes scored a hat-trick as Manchester United came from behind to beat Ipswich 5-2 at Old Trafford and pick up their first win of the season.

It looked like being a difficult afternoon for Michael Carrick's team early on. Julio Enciso and Daizen Maeda both forced smart stops from Senne Lammens before Abdul Fatawu skinned Luke Shaw and fed Leif Davis to side-foot the opener high into the United net.

Old Trafford was edgy at that point, with United having lost to Hull on the opening weekend. But the game turned when Marcelino Nunez slipped over. Matheus Cunha robbed the Chilean midfielder and found Fernandes, who slammed the ball home with his left foot.

Bryan Mbeumo should have completed the turnaround early in the second half only to strike the bar from close range, but United did not have to wait long. Their second was not without controversy, however, as Harry Maguire escaped punishment for a handball.

Had his shot gone straight into the net then it would have been disallowed but because the attempt was diverted in by Jacob Greaves, it was allowed to stand. Moments later, United took the game away from Ipswich as Greaves' unfortunate afternoon continued.

The defender brought down Cunha when he was through on goal, and Fernandes, who had missed twice from the spot during pre-season, converted the penalty. It was party time thereafter, with Fernandes completing his hat-trick by slotting home in the 68th minute.

The skipper was not done. A wedged pass in behind found Mbeumo, who lobbed the goalkeeper to make it five. As the rain came down, Ipswich did pull one back in stoppage time through substitute Chuba Akpom but it was far too little and far too late.

With academy graduates Kobbie Mainoo and Marcus Rashford back in the starting line-up - in Rashford's case, for the first time since 2024 - there was a real mood of optimism inside the stadium at the end. Not perfect. But Manchester United's firepower is clear.
